Windows Microsoft Guardian is designed to imitate actions of a security program, but it’s not really functional. The purpose of Windows Microsoft Guardian is looking like a useful thing; this is supposed to trick people into purchasing the tool. Do not give your money away to scammers and remove Windows Microsoft Guardian with no doubt.
Windows Microsoft Guardian is usually installed by trojans but it is also promoted on fake ‘security scanners’ online. Avoid installing the fraud: once it gets on a computer, Windows Microsoft Guardian is difficult to delete.
Windows Microsoft Guardian loads large amounts of warnings. The pop-ups imitate security warnings so it may intimidate victims into buying the rogue antispyware. Avoid the trap and remove Windows MicrosoftGuardian as soon as it gets onboard.
